## Summary

The Driver and Vehicle Standards Agency (DVSA) is conducting a procurement process titled "Enterprise Workforce Scheduling" focused on IT services for consulting and software development. This project is located in the UK and is currently in the Award stage, with a contract awarded to Deloitte LLP for a value of £498,575. The contract commenced on 17 September 2018 and is set to conclude on 17 December 2018. The procurement method employed is selective, specifically a call-off from a framework agreement, with the tender period having ended on 17 August 2018.

## Notice

DVSA is responsible for road safety across the UK. The agency carries out driving tests, approves people to be driving instructors and MOT testers, carries out tests to make sure lorries and buses are safe to drive, carries out enforcement roadside checks on drivers and vehicles, and monitors vehicle recalls. The DVSA has a need to schedule staff to support Driver testing, Vehicle testing and Enforcement activities. Each of these business areas has developed their own processes and, in some cases, IT applications to manage the scheduling of their resources. The Enterprise Workforce Schedule Project (EWS) will deliver an efficient method of scheduling DVSA employees within Vehicle Testing, Enforcement and Driver Testing. The vision for scheduling is to provide a digitally enabled single scheduling service, which efficiently manages our people, ensuring that we provide the right person at the right place, and at the right time. The DVSA will run separate work streams for Vehicle Testing, Enforcement and Driver Testing. Each work stream will have its own Alpha, Beta and Live Phases, the exception will be the Vehicle Testing stream. The Alpha phase for Vehicle Testing will consist of two parts, the majority of Vehicle Testing Alpha will be delivered in Alpha (a) which is ahead of product procurement. Vehicle Testing Alpha (b) will completed when the scheduling product has been selected. The DVSA is appointing a Supplier for the Alpha phase for Vehicle Testing only.
